WAAAAY back in the day, it was common-place for mages to summon a Muzzle of Mardu and get an enchanter to charm an NPC and then hand them a mask. I remember after leaving the shroom king camp in Sebilis, the enchanter in our guild would charm each NPC and then I gave them a mask.

As you can imagine, this made it very difficult for another group to move in and take the camp, as it was difficult enough on its own.

I believe if they spawn with equipment on their loot table, they get the haste from the item. But it was changed so that items given to an NPC after they are spawned do not give them any haste (regular summoned pets excluded, of course).
